Rain Gauge Quantity. The inner tube’s diameter is just small enough to make the depth of rain ten times what it would be in a gauge without the tube and funnel. The recommended diameter for a rain gauge is 8 inches. A rain gauge is a meteorological instrument that is used to measure the amount of precipitation (mostly rainfall) that accumulates. This size is standardized for use by the national weather service and is widely adopted worldwide to ensure consistent and accurate measurement of rainfall. A rain gauge is an instrument designed to collect and measure the amount of liquid precipitation over a set period of time. The rain gauge measures the height of the rainwater level in millimetres.
